Nonprofit health plan Health Alliance Plan in Detroit has named Laurie Doran senior vice president and CFO.

Doran brings nearly 30 years of financial leadership experience in the health care industry.  Most recently, she was a consulting partner to the Association of Community Affiliated Health Plans and served as a business strategy adviser to providers, payers, and government with a focus on growth opportunities, health plan operations, and provider payment innovations.

Previously, she served as CFO and chief customer officer of BMC HealthNet Plan, which was established by Boston Medical Center and is one of the largest Medicaid health plans in Massachusetts.  She also spent 12 years at Harvard Pilgrim Health Care in Massachusetts, where she led finance teams including medical economics, actuarial systems, reporting, and analysis.

She also held positions at the Department of Veterans Affairs/Veterans Health Administration, Group Health Inc., Bristol Group Inc., and Massachusetts General Hospital.

“Laurie’s vast experience encompasses not only finance and health care, but also managing government programs, particularly those that serve the Medicaid population and their unique needs,” says Dr. Michael Genord, interim president and CEO of HAP.  “Her wide-ranging expertise will serve HAP well as we continue to expand our reach into key markets and serve these important but vulnerable members.”

Doran holds a master’s degree in public health from Yale University and a bachelor’s degree in health management and policy from the University of New Hampshire.

HAP has offered health coverage for nearly 60 years.
